I was worried that the 'base' Burmester system wouldn't be good enough for me - I am coming from the top end systems in Lincoln vehicles. I normally spec my vehicles with top of the line everything, but the 3D system was a $6,900 upcharge which gave me pause.

The base system has met my expectations (I'm no audiophile) but I do find it lacking in the sense that the sound comes from lower in the cabin than I'm used to. I assume that's because I didn't spring for the high end system which places the extra speakers higher on the door pillars and in the ceiling, more like the Revel Ultima 28-speaker system in my old Aviator.

The base system also does not lack in bass.

I have to jump in here. Yes the 3D audio does play Loud. Much louder than you really know, without a dB meter. That's because there is such a low level of distortion and artifacts, that you don't get "listener fatigue," which makes you want to turn down the sound.

I do call myself an Audiophile, and I "audition" auto sound systems. I take my own sources of various music and spend a half hour listening, at rest and on the road. I had a job in College, while I was studying Acoustics, that turned out to be an expensive experience. I was a Paid Listener for an electronic organ company as they refined their sound profiles. (Their test room consisted of 120 12" speakers, driven by 60 McIntosh amps, capable of 8Hz at 120dB!) I learned what makes speakers/electronics sound bad and good, and I've paid extra over the years to avoid the bad, in my home systems.

The Burmester 3D is the purest audio I have experienced in a car. Including really high dollar, audiophile custom jobs, and of course the high end offerings from many auto brands.
It's phase coherency, time alignment and driver (speaker) control are excellent. The Acoustic match to the car is great.

All these features make it really enjoyable to listen to, especially at low levels, which is an acid test.
Then, select "VIP Seat" and all that time alignment, phase coherency and impact is focused on YOU and it's exhilarating / calming / revealing. (You can select one seat, a row of seats, or all seats.)

I spent 3,000 miles in our prior GLE450 with 3D Audio. I would take it out on drives just to enjoy the sound (memory stick). Or just sit in the garage listening. I miss it a lot.
